Ticket: Staging env misconfigured for Siftgate bloom filter

The bloom layer in front of the Pellet KV store is rejecting all lookups in staging because the env file was copied from the dev template without credentials. False-positive tuning values are fine; only the auth line is missing. To unblock the weekly demo, the Pellet admission secret must be set on the following line.

env line for yaguf-fajop: LEDGER_TOKEN13=fb08984397349

Fan-out backpressure for the Quillet notifier: when the queue depth crosses the soft limit, the dispatcher sheds low-priority pushes and batches the rest at 500ms intervals. Reviewer should confirm the shed counter is exported and that retries respect the jitter window. Once merged, the release artifact gets re-signed by the pipeline, which expects the deploy key shown below.

deploy key for bawep-yawif: bky6_GQhaSt

Handover: Chiptrace reader at the Marlowe Bay Marathon

Hi team — handing over the Chiptrace timing-chip reader before I'm out next week. The reader at the finish arch was re-flashed after the dropout during the Harrowgate half, and it has been stable since. Watch for read-rate dips below 95% in the dashboard; that usually means antenna misalignment, not firmware. Power-cycling is safe mid-race but resyncs take about 40 seconds. Escalate anything else to the timing vendor. The reader currently runs with this configuration.

settings of yageg-yahap:
[gorael]
team = olieth
access_code = ac_941d74
owner = brieth.aldiel
host = gorael.tolvaqio.internal
port = 6379
peer = briwyn.urlaqtech.internal
salt = 116e6622
pin = 1957

Night shift: evacuation-chair store on Stairwell C, Level 3, was restocked today. Two Havermont chairs serviced, one sent to Drayle Safety for repair. Check the seal on the store door at 02:00 rounds. If the seal is broken, log it and re-secure. Door access for the store uses the pass below.

staff pass of fajop-kajop = bdg-H-83